Where is the Felzer family from?

You can see how Felzer families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Felzer family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Scotland between 1840 and 1920. The most Felzer families were found in USA in 1920. In 1891 there was 1 Felzer family living in London. This was 100% of all the recorded Felzer's in United Kingdom. London had the highest population of Felzer families in 1891.

What did your Felzer 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Farmer and Housewife were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Felzer. 35% of Felzer men worked as a Farmer and 60% of Felzer women worked as a Housewife. Some less common occupations for Americans named Felzer were New Worker and Housekeeper.

What is the average Felzer lifespan?

Between 1960 and 2004, in the United States, Felzer life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1977, and highest in 2004. The average life expectancy for Felzer in 1960 was 58, and 93 in 2004.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Felzer 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
